+/**
+ * Version of LockManager that uses a quorum from peer servers for locks.
+ * The resource space can also be sharded into separate peer groups.
+ *
+ * @ingroup LockManager
+ * @since 1.20
+ */
+abstract class QuorumLockManager extends LockManager {
+       /** @var Array Map of bucket indexes to peer server lists */
+       protected $srvsByBucket = array(); // (bucket index => (lsrv1, lsrv2, ...))
+
+       /**
+        * @see LockManager::doLock()
+        * @param $paths array
+        * @param $type int
+        * @return Status
+        */
+       final protected function doLock( array $paths, $type ) {
+               $status = Status::newGood();
+
+               $pathsToLock = array(); // (bucket => paths)
+               // Get locks that need to be acquired (buckets => locks)...
+               foreach ( $paths as $path ) {
+                       if ( isset( $this->locksHeld[$path][$type] ) ) {
+                               ++$this->locksHeld[$path][$type];
+                       } elseif ( isset( $this->locksHeld[$path][self::LOCK_EX] ) ) {
+                               $this->locksHeld[$path][$type] = 1;
+                       } else {
+                               $bucket = $this->getBucketFromKey( $path );
+                               $pathsToLock[$bucket][] = $path;
+                       }
+               }
+
+               $lockedPaths = array(); // files locked in this attempt
+               // Attempt to acquire these locks...
+               foreach ( $pathsToLock as $bucket => $paths ) {
+                       // Try to acquire the locks for this bucket
+                       $status->merge( $this->doLockingRequestBucket( $bucket, $paths, $type ) );
+                       if ( !$status->isOK() ) {
+                               $status->merge( $this->doUnlock( $lockedPaths, $type ) );
+                               return $status;
+                       }
+                       // Record these locks as active
+                       foreach ( $paths as $path ) {
+                               $this->locksHeld[$path][$type] = 1; // locked
+                       }
+                       // Keep track of what locks were made in this attempt
+                       $lockedPaths = array_merge( $lockedPaths, $paths );
+               }
+
+               return $status;
+       }
+
+       /**
+        * @see LockManager::doUnlock()
+        * @param $paths array
+        * @param $type int
+        * @return Status
+        */
+       final protected function doUnlock( array $paths, $type ) {
+               $status = Status::newGood();
+
+               $pathsToUnlock = array();
+               foreach ( $paths as $path ) {
+                       if ( !isset( $this->locksHeld[$path][$type] ) ) {
+                               $status->warning( 'lockmanager-notlocked', $path );
+                       } else {
+                               --$this->locksHeld[$path][$type];
+                               // Reference count the locks held and release locks when zero
+                               if ( $this->locksHeld[$path][$type] <= 0 ) {
+                                       unset( $this->locksHeld[$path][$type] );
+                                       $bucket = $this->getBucketFromKey( $path );
+                                       $pathsToUnlock[$bucket][] = $path;
+                               }
+                               if ( !count( $this->locksHeld[$path] ) ) {
+                                       unset( $this->locksHeld[$path] ); // no SH or EX locks left for key
+                               }
+                       }
+               }
+
+               // Remove these specific locks if possible, or at least release
+               // all locks once this process is currently not holding any locks.
+               foreach ( $pathsToUnlock as $bucket => $paths ) {
+                       $status->merge( $this->doUnlockingRequestBucket( $bucket, $paths, $type ) );
+               }
+               if ( !count( $this->locksHeld ) ) {
+                       $status->merge( $this->releaseAllLocks() );
+               }
+
+               return $status;
+       }
+
+       /**
+        * Attempt to acquire locks with the peers for a bucket.
+        * This is all or nothing; if any key is locked then this totally fails.
+        *
+        * @param $bucket integer
+        * @param $paths Array List of resource keys to lock
+        * @param $type integer LockManager::LOCK_EX or LockManager::LOCK_SH
+        * @return Status
+        */
+       final protected function doLockingRequestBucket( $bucket, array $paths, $type ) {
+               $status = Status::newGood();
+
+               $yesVotes = 0; // locks made on trustable servers
+               $votesLeft = count( $this->srvsByBucket[$bucket] ); // remaining peers
+               $quorum = floor( $votesLeft/2 + 1 ); // simple majority
+               // Get votes for each peer, in order, until we have enough...
+               foreach ( $this->srvsByBucket[$bucket] as $lockSrv ) {
+                       if ( !$this->isServerUp( $lockSrv ) ) {
+                               --$votesLeft;
+                               $status->warning( 'lockmanager-fail-svr-acquire', $lockSrv );
+                               continue; // server down?
+                       }
+                       // Attempt to acquire the lock on this peer
+                       $status->merge( $this->getLocksOnServer( $lockSrv, $paths, $type ) );
+                       if ( !$status->isOK() ) {
+                               return $status; // vetoed; resource locked
+                       }
+                       ++$yesVotes; // success for this peer
+                       if ( $yesVotes >= $quorum ) {
+                               return $status; // lock obtained
+                       }
+                       --$votesLeft;
+                       $votesNeeded = $quorum - $yesVotes;
+                       if ( $votesNeeded > $votesLeft ) {
+                               break; // short-circuit
+                       }
+               }
+               // At this point, we must not have met the quorum
+               $status->setResult( false );
+
+               return $status;
+       }
+
+       /**
+        * Attempt to release locks with the peers for a bucket
+        *
+        * @param $bucket integer
+        * @param $paths Array List of resource keys to lock
+        * @param $type integer LockManager::LOCK_EX or LockManager::LOCK_SH
+        * @return Status
+        */
+       final protected function doUnlockingRequestBucket( $bucket, array $paths, $type ) {
+               $status = Status::newGood();
+
+               foreach ( $this->srvsByBucket[$bucket] as $lockSrv ) {
+                       if ( !$this->isServerUp( $lockSrv ) ) {
+                               $status->fatal( 'lockmanager-fail-svr-release', $lockSrv );
+                       // Attempt to release the lock on this peer
+                       } else {
+                               $status->merge( $this->freeLocksOnServer( $lockSrv, $paths, $type ) );
+                       }
+               }
+
+               return $status;
+       }
+
+       /**
+        * Get the bucket for resource path.
+        * This should avoid throwing any exceptions.
+        *
+        * @param $path string
+        * @return integer
+        */
+       protected function getBucketFromKey( $path ) {
+               $prefix = substr( sha1( $path ), 0, 2 ); // first 2 hex chars (8 bits)
+               return (int)base_convert( $prefix, 16, 10 ) % count( $this->srvsByBucket );
+       }
+
+       /**
+        * Check if a lock server is up
+        *
+        * @param $lockSrv string
+        * @return bool
+        */
+       abstract protected function isServerUp( $lockSrv );
+
+       /**
+        * Get a connection to a lock server and acquire locks on $paths
+        *
+        * @param $lockSrv string
+        * @param $paths array
+        * @param $type integer
+        * @return Status
+        */
+       abstract protected function getLocksOnServer( $lockSrv, array $paths, $type );
+
+       /**
+        * Get a connection to a lock server and release locks on $paths.
+        *
+        * Subclasses must effectively implement this or releaseAllLocks().
+        *
+        * @param $lockSrv string
+        * @param $paths array
+        * @param $type integer
+        * @return Status
+        */
+       abstract protected function freeLocksOnServer( $lockSrv, array $paths, $type );
+
+       /**
+        * Release all locks that this session is holding.
+        *
+        * Subclasses must effectively implement this or freeLocksOnServer().
+        *
+        * @return Status
+        */
+       abstract protected function releaseAllLocks();
+}
